Empire is the second album by British indie rock

 band Kasabian, released in August 2006. The album went onto #1 in the UK Albums Chart

 upon its release and was preceded by the release of new single

 "Empire" on 24 July 2006.

The album was recorded over two weeks after touring with Oasis

. According to Tom Meighan

 in an interview on the album with the NME

in early 2006, "Empire" is a word used by the band to describe something that is good. To date the album has sold over 1 million copies worldwide, including more than 600,000 in the UK.
